Efficiencies

IQE - internal quantum efficiency

is calculated as

(2.2.45)ηIQE=IphotoItotal

where Itotal is the total injected current consisted of both electron and hole currents.

The electrical power and optical power are calculated and output in power.dat:

RQE - volume quantum efficiency

, which is also called as radiative quantum efficiency, is calculated as

(2.2.46)ηVQE=Rrad,netstim+RfixedRtotal

where Rtotal=Rrad,netstim+Rfixed+RAuger+RSRH is the total recombination rate including both radiative and non-radiative recombination.

Both ηIQE and ηVQE agree if the electrons and holes injected into the active region are fully consumed up by the recombination there. However, if they are not consumed up, eRtotal<Icharge and this results in ηIQE1>ηIQE2
